> I _think_ that the users are supposed to change the IP of the secundary DNS 
> in their zone files... :-(

Users shouldn't have the IP address of ns2.granitecanyon.com in their
zone files!  The main problem is that NSI's whois db and thus the GTLD
servers have the old address.  The effect is that anyone who quotes the
two GC NSs really only has one contactable server at the moment.  It's
up to Granite Canyon's people (and they don't have a technical contact
listed in whois!) to update that.  In fact the whois record has a
different list of nameservers for the granitecanyon.com domain than
GC's servers are giving out - timely maintenance seems to be lacking.  :-(
